What Is Thymoquinone?

Thymoquinone is a naturally occurring molecule in black seed oil’s volatile fraction. Its potency depends on: Thymoquinone is a naturally occurring bioactive molecule found within the volatile fraction of black seed oil. Its natural potency depends on:

1. Seed genetics
2. Soil nutrition
3. Climate and rainfall
4. Harvest practices
5. Cold-pressing methods

Authentic, naturally grown black seed oil will show natural variations from batch to batch and this is a sign of real, unaltered oil.

The Problem With Industry Claims

Some oils advertise TQ levels like:

4%, 5% and even 10%. These numbers are often unrealistic for naturally occurring oil.

Independent studies show:

Typical cold-pressed black seed oils: 0.3–1.8% TQ
Strong, high-quality oils: 1.2–1.8% TQ
Rare, exceptionally potent batches: up to ~2% TQ

Claims above 2% are usually synthetic thymoquinone added into the oil:

Chemically concentrated extracts
Non-validated testing
Marketing exaggeration

How We Verify Thymoquinone: USP GC-FID Method

Our oil’s thymoquinone content is measured using GC-FID (Gas Chromatography – Flame Ionisation Detection) following the USP (United States Pharmacopeia) method.

What this means:

• Accurate and precise: Separates and measures TQ directly in the oil.
Globally recognised standard: USP methods are validated and repeatable.
• Batch-specific verification: Each batch of our oil is independently tested in an Australian lab.
Proves natural integrity: No synthetic TQ is added, what you see is what nature produced.

How to Identify Trustworthy Black Seed Oil

Look for:

✔ Batch-specific COA (Certificate of Analysis)
✔ USP GC-FID or HPLC testing
✔ Naturally achievable TQ values (≤2%)
✔ Cold-pressed, solvent-free extraction
✔ No synthetic additives
✔ Transparent sourcing and testing

If any of these answers are “no” or unclear, the claim is likely marketing hype.
